可观察性平台如何支持实时监控告警?
在当今数字化时代,企业对于IT系统的稳定性和安全性要求越来越高。为了确保业务连续性和数据安全,实时监控告警成为了企业运维不可或缺的一部分。而可观察性平台作为企业运维的重要工具,如何支持实时监控告警,成为了许多企业关注的焦点。本文将深入探讨可观察性平台在实时监控告警方面的作用,以及如何实现高效、精准的告警管理。
一、可观察性平台概述
可观察性平台是指一种能够实时监控、收集、分析和可视化IT系统运行状态的工具。它主要包括以下几个功能:
监控:实时监控IT系统的性能、状态和资源使用情况。
收集:收集系统日志、事件、性能指标等数据。
分析:对收集到的数据进行深度分析,发现潜在问题。
可视化:将分析结果以图表、报表等形式展示,便于运维人员快速定位问题。
二、可观察性平台在实时监控告警中的作用
- 及时发现异常
可观察性平台通过实时监控,能够及时发现系统中的异常情况。当系统出现性能瓶颈、资源紧张、错误日志等异常时,平台会立即触发告警,通知运维人员处理。
- 精准定位问题
可观察性平台对收集到的数据进行深度分析,能够帮助运维人员精准定位问题。通过分析告警数据,可以快速找到问题的根源,提高问题解决效率。
- 自动化处理
部分可观察性平台支持自动化处理功能,当系统出现告警时,平台可以自动执行相应的处理措施,如重启服务、调整资源等,减轻运维人员的工作负担。
- 历史数据查询
可观察性平台能够存储历史告警数据,便于运维人员查询和分析。通过对历史数据的分析,可以总结经验,优化系统配置,降低故障发生概率。
三、可观察性平台实现实时监控告警的关键技术
- 数据采集技术
可观察性平台需要采集大量的数据,包括系统日志、性能指标、事件等。数据采集技术包括:
- Agent技术:通过在系统上部署Agent,实时收集数据。
- SNMP技术:通过SNMP协议,从网络设备中采集数据。
- 日志分析技术:对系统日志进行解析,提取关键信息。
- 数据处理技术
可观察性平台需要对采集到的数据进行处理,包括:
- 数据清洗:去除无效、重复的数据。
- 数据聚合:将相同类型的数据进行合并。
- 数据存储:将处理后的数据存储到数据库中。
- 数据分析技术
可观察性平台需要对数据进行深度分析,包括:
- 异常检测:识别异常数据,触发告警。
- 趋势分析:分析数据变化趋势,预测潜在问题。
- 关联分析:分析不同数据之间的关系,发现潜在问题。
- 可视化技术
可观察性平台需要将分析结果以图表、报表等形式展示,便于运维人员快速定位问题。可视化技术包括:
- 图表库:提供丰富的图表类型,如柱状图、折线图、饼图等。
- 报表生成:自动生成报表,便于运维人员查看。
四、案例分析
某企业采用可观察性平台进行实时监控告警,取得了显著效果。以下是该企业实施过程中的一些关键步骤:
数据采集:在服务器、网络设备、数据库等关键设备上部署Agent,实时采集数据。
数据处理:对采集到的数据进行清洗、聚合和存储。
数据分析:对存储的数据进行异常检测、趋势分析和关联分析。
可视化展示:将分析结果以图表、报表等形式展示,便于运维人员快速定位问题。
自动化处理:当系统出现告警时,平台自动执行相应的处理措施,如重启服务、调整资源等。
通过实施可观察性平台,该企业实现了以下效果:
- 故障响应时间缩短50%
- 故障解决效率提高30%
- 系统稳定性提高20%
总结
可观察性平台在实时监控告警方面发挥着重要作用。通过实时监控、精准定位、自动化处理和历史数据查询等功能,可观察性平台能够帮助企业提高运维效率,降低故障发生概率。随着技术的不断发展,可观察性平台将在企业运维领域发挥越来越重要的作用。
猜你喜欢:云原生可观测性